Difficulty using with vision impairments
I use Windows 10 with the High Contrast #1 theme because of my vision problems. I need light text on a dark background, otherwise I can only briefly glance at the screen and read text only with great difficulty.
Much of the text is a fixed color and is nearly invisible against the black background. This is the case with both webpages and the Tor's Options, where the check boxes look the same whether checked or not.
Also, some picture don't appear. This is a minor but related problem that Microsoft fixed in Edge a while back.
I just downloaded the Tor Browser v6.5.2 today, 5/26/2017.
